How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chesapeake Gardens Mamie Homes?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chesapeake Gardens Mamie Homes Studio Apartments | $1,435 | $1,136 | $1,629 |
| Chesapeake Gardens Mamie Homes 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,561 | $850 | $2,859 |
| Chesapeake Gardens Mamie Homes 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,709 | $995 | $3,059 |
| Chesapeake Gardens Mamie Homes 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,192 | $1,045 | $3,969 |
| Chesapeake Gardens Mamie Homes 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,830 | $1,830 | $1,830 |
